Transaction d6a511d331acc69ec3af58798881acdd3a4717b2410f01c1f8bb0b3a07474a13
1 Input
1 Output
-
d6a511d331acc69ec3af58798881acdd3a4717b2410f01c1f8bb0b3a07474a13:0
- value
- 644451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51eaa5d5907526a4ad1538b80b28d6d6f7815a0a OP_EQUAL
- address
- 39A9khLZfwrARJ8Vfm5HT294A3m25Mkghd